Re: Okay Sharon... - Harborwitch - 02-03-2009 Beautiful peppers!!! Re: Okay Sharon... - luvnit - 02-03-2009 This really was just as easy as frying fish! First I roasted the peppers: Then I peeled and deseeded them. Then I stuffed them with cheese, rolled and floured them: Then I whipped the egg whites and yolks separately: Then folded that mixture together into one lovely batter: Then I fried them in my cast iron skillet (excuse my mess): Then I plated it and served it with a red sauce and some salsa verde: These were soooo good and really easy to make.
